See Dr., then eat...: If one is truly underweight (based on height, family background, and body type), a dr. Can evaluate for a hormonal, digestive, or other disorder. If no medical cause is found, then one can add weight by eating more calories of nutritious foods, while also doing weight-training to increase muscle. Proteins: egg white, chicken breast, salmon, ... Better fats: olive oil, peanuts, almonds, tofu, ....

Emergency: If this is not a typo and you are at 43lbs, this is an emergency situation. Your body mass index is at 7.38 which is usually not life sustainable. You must go to the hospital immediately for medical stabilization and weight restoration. At your bmi you cannot gain weight fast as this will lead to a condition called refeeding syndrome which can also lead to sudden death.
